RAID技术解析与磁盘存取时间计算
需积分: 0 69 浏览量
更新于2024-08-05
收藏 1012KB PDF 举报
"文件管理答案1"
这篇资料主要涉及了磁盘存取时间和RAID(冗余磁盘阵列)的相关知识。在磁盘存取时间方面,它提到了两个关键部分:平均寻道时间和找到扇区的时间。平均寻道时间是指磁头移动到目标磁道所需的时间,这里是6毫秒;找到扇区的时间则是磁盘转半圈所需时间,计算为3毫秒。磁盘控制器延迟时间和数据传输时间也是影响总体存取时间的因素。
在RAID技术的介绍中,重点讲解了镜像、数据条带和数据校验这三大关键技术。镜像是通过复制数据到多个磁盘来提高可靠性和读性能,但写性能会降低。数据条带是将数据分片存储在不同磁盘上,增强并发读写性能。数据校验则利用冗余数据进行错误检测和修复,提高系统的可靠性,但可能影响性能。RAID的不同级别结合这些技术以平衡数据安全、性能和成本。
题目中还涉及了一些计算,如磁盘的转速和数据传输率的计算。例如,一个转速为7200转/分钟的磁盘,每转有160个扇区,每个扇区512字节,那么数据传输率为9600KB/s。
此外,RAID级别的选择需要根据具体系统需求,包括对数据可靠性的要求、期望的I/O性能以及成本考量。不同的RAID级别(如RAID 0、RAID 1、RAID 5、RAID 6等)有不同的特点和适用场景。
在实际应用中,理解这些原理对于优化存储系统性能、提高数据安全性以及有效管理磁盘资源至关重要。磁盘存取时间的优化可以提升系统整体的响应速度,而RAID技术的选择和配置则直接影响到系统的稳定性和可用性。因此,掌握这些知识对于IT专业人士来说是必不可少的。
2014-12-25 上传
348 浏览量
2022-03-07 上传
2018-04-10 上传
苏采
- 粉丝: 18
- 资源: 300
最新资源
- Python中快速友好的MessagePack序列化库msgspec
- 大学生社团管理系统设计与实现
- 基于Netbeans和JavaFX的宿舍管理系统开发与实践
- NodeJS打造Discord机器人:kazzcord功能全解析
- 小学教学与管理一体化:校务管理系统v***
- AppDeploy neXtGen:无需代理的Windows AD集成软件自动分发
- 基于SSM和JSP技术的网上商城系统开发
- 探索ANOIRA16的GitHub托管测试网站之路
- 语音性别识别:机器学习模型的精确度提升策略
- 利用MATLAB代码让古董486电脑焕发新生
- Erlang VM上的分布式生命游戏实现与Elixir设计
- 一键下载管理 - Go to Downloads-crx插件
- Java SSM框架开发的客户关系管理系统
- 使用SQL数据库和Django开发应用程序指南
- Spring Security实战指南:详细示例与应用
- Quarkus项目测试展示柜:Cucumber与FitNesse实践